How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cove?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Cove 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,767 | $1,390 | $4,645 |
Cove 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,021 | $1,615 | $3,261 |
Cove 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,694 | $1,825 | $9,939 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Cove Apartments
What is the price of a cheap apartment in Cove?
The cheapest apartment in Cove is Captiva Club Apartments which is listed at $1,509, while the average apartment in Cove costs $2,382.
What types of apartments are the cheapest in Cove?
Student, low-income, and by-the-bed apartments are typically the cheapest rentals in most cities, though they require qualifying criteria to rent. There are 544 regular apartments in Cove that we think qualify as ‘cheap apartments’ that do not have special requirements to apply to rent.
